Output 344e48e31c15e2b5dc74fa2ea26fd56886c25e40bcaca3878cbbeb4b086081c2:646

value
23370569
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81e1237f229daade9247435d73e7bad51063d77b OP_EQUALVERIFY OP_CHECKSIG
address
1CqjsexJ1SLc2MHTFZuL9epNCdcV24abPg
transaction
344e48e31c15e2b5dc74fa2ea26fd56886c25e40bcaca3878cbbeb4b086081c2
spent
true